Practice

Without courage we cannot practice any other virtue with consistency.

We can’t be kind, true, merciful, generous, or honest.

Maya Angelou

elevate

I want to feel both the beauty and the pain of the age we are living in. I want to survive my life without becoming numb. I want to speak and comprehend words of wounding without having these words become the landscape where I dwell. I want to possess a light touch that can elevate darkness to the realm of stars.

Terry Tempest Williams
